Executive Summary
The August 2026 threat landscape demonstrates an accelerating convergence of AI-augmented vulnerability discovery, rapid weaponization of proof-of-concept exploits, and expanding third-party risk exposure. Microsoft SharePoint authentication bypass CVE-2026-55040 (CVSS 9.1) moved from patch availability to active exploitation within days of public PoC release Attackers Exploit SharePoint Authentication Bypass After Public PoC Release, while a maximum-severity SAP Commerce Cloud remote code execution flaw faced targeting within three days of patching Max severity SAP Commerce Cloud flaw now targeted in attacks. This compression of the exploit timeline demands continuous vulnerability management rather than monthly patch cycles.
Third-party and supply chain risk materialized in a €30 million banking fraud spanning Brazil and Europe, where attackers exploited a service provider vulnerability to access Commerzbank customer accounts Hackers arrested over €30M bank fraud exploiting service provider flaw. Simultaneously, the Scottish Government disclosed a potentially widening data breach originating from a third-party provider that may service multiple agencies Scottish Govt Suffers Potentially Widening Data Breach at Prosecutor's Office, underscoring cascading risk across shared service ecosystems.
Identity and access control paradigms are shifting as AI agents proliferate. Cyera's $1 billion acquisition of Oasis Security aims to converge data security and identity into a single control plane for agents, redefining privileged access around business context rather than static roles Cyera's Oasis Security Buy Is All About AI Agent Control. Meanwhile, Google Workspace attacks increasingly leverage stolen OAuth tokens rather than phishing, requiring defenses covering the full Workspace attack chain The Modern Attack Chain: Rethinking Google Workspace Security in the Age of AI.
Regulatory and standards bodies are responding to AI-driven vulnerability volume surges. NIST is evaluating whether AI can help manage the tsunami of AI-augmented bug discoveries Amid AI-Driven Bug-Hunt Tsunami, NIST Looks to … AI, while Anthropic advances watermarking for AI-generated content identification How Anthropic plans to watermark Claude's AI-generated text. Boards continue to underestimate technology risk until crisis emergence, per Dark Reading analysis What Boards Need to Know About Tech Risk.

Recommendations for Action
Immediate (0-30 Days)
- Activate emergency patching for actively exploited critical vulnerabilities — Prioritize Microsoft SharePoint CVE-2026-55040 (CVSS 9.1) and SAP Commerce Cloud RCE; validate patch deployment across all internet-facing instances Attackers Exploit SharePoint Authentication Bypass After Public PoC Release; Max severity SAP Commerce Cloud flaw now targeted in attacks
- Audit third-party service provider access and monitoring — Review all providers with access to financial systems or sensitive data; enforce contractual breach notification SLAs; implement continuous fourth-party risk visibility Hackers arrested over €30M bank fraud exploiting service provider flaw; Scottish Govt Suffers Potentially Widening Data Breach at Prosecutor's Office
- Deploy OAuth token anomaly detection for Google Workspace and SaaS platforms — Implement token binding, geovelocity analysis, and automated revocation for suspicious token activity The Modern Attack Chain: Rethinking Google Workspace Security in the Age of AI
Near-Term (30-90 Days)
- Transition vulnerability management to continuous, risk-based prioritization — Integrate threat intelligence feeds tracking PoC availability and exploitation evidence; adopt NIST-aligned AI-assisted triage as guidance emerges Amid AI-Driven Bug-Hunt Tsunami, NIST Looks to … AI; Attackers Exploit SharePoint Authentication Bypass After Public PoC Release
- Establish AI agent identity governance framework — Define agent registration, least-privilege scoping by business context, and session monitoring; evaluate converged data security and identity platforms Cyera's Oasis Security Buy Is All About AI Agent Control
- Harden internet-facing gateway devices and monitor for SOCKS5 abuse — Enforce firmware update policies, disable unnecessary remote management, and deploy network traffic analysis for anomalous relay behavior New Evooo1Bot Linux botnet turns routers into traffic relay nodes
Strategic (90-180 Days)
- Elevate technology risk reporting to board level with quantitative metrics — Implement risk scenario modeling, control effectiveness measurement, and crisis simulation exercises addressing board blind spots What Boards Need to Know About Tech Risk; Mission-Driven Security: Inside a Global Bank's Defense
- Adopt AI content provenance controls — Pilot watermarking detection for inbound communications and document workflows; prepare for regulatory requirements on AI-generated content disclosure How Anthropic plans to watermark Claude's AI-generated text
- Align security leadership development with business strategy — Invest in CISO and security executive programs emphasizing commercial acumen, AI risk literacy, and stakeholder influence Mission-Driven Security: Inside a Global Bank's Defense
